$NetBSD: patch-lib_rdoc_ri_driver.rb,v 1.1 2014/03/14 19:40:47 taca Exp $ * Defer loading readline, when it is really needed. Some unknown reason: 1. build devel/ruby-readline with editline(3). 2. Execute a ruby script loading readline in background from shell. 3. When the script output something to stdout, it got SIGTSTP and suspends.
